Transaction 70559aba8ce503e24acd7c107218ac578c0f74942370726b7775403e997c01dc

1 Input
2 Outputs
  • 70559aba8ce503e24acd7c107218ac578c0f74942370726b7775403e997c01dc:0
  • value  15736
    address  3AJLpKpMaHQPraerCiqnT7xmkAinhn7Jec
  • 70559aba8ce503e24acd7c107218ac578c0f74942370726b7775403e997c01dc:1
  • value  39443563
    address  3AgTAm6JNAPnhumMigfmQMkWaWna8u4wCx